Actor Mukul Dev Passes Away at 54, Film Industry in Shock

Mumbai: Bollywood actor Mukul Dev, known for his versatile roles in Son of Sardaar, R… Rajkumar, and Jai Ho, passed away on Friday night at the age of 54. The sudden demise of the actor has left the Indian film industry and his admirers in mourning.

Admitted to ICU, cause of death still unknown

While a formal statement from his family is awaited, sources close to the actor confirmed that Mukul had been unwell and was recently admitted to the Intensive Care Unit (ICU). The exact cause of death is not yet publicly known.

Actress and long-time friend Deepshikha Nagpal confirmed the news via Instagram, posting a throwback photo and the caption “RIP.” In a conversation with IANS, she said, “We were friends beyond the screen… I still can’t believe it—it feels like fake news.” Deepshikha described him as “a fantastic human being” and “an amazing actor.”

Industry pays tribute to a warm, talented artist

Tributes from the film fraternity have poured in across social media platforms. Actor Sonu Sood tweeted, “RIP Mukul bhai. You were a gem. Will always miss you. Stay strong @RahulDevRising bhai.” Mukul Dev was the brother of actor Rahul Dev.

Actor Vindu Dara Singh shared a video of their 2024 interaction, writing, “Rest in peace my brother #MukulDev! Son Of Sardaar 2 will be your swansong—spreading joy and laughter as always.”

Veteran actor Manoj Bajpayee wrote a moving message on Instagram: “It’s impossible to put into words what I’m feeling. Mukul was a brother in spirit, an artist whose warmth and passion were unmatched. Gone too soon, too young. Miss you meri jaan. Om Shanti.”

Legacy in cinema

Mukul Dev began his career in 1996 with the television series Mumkin and made his film debut the same year in Dastak, co-starring Sushmita Sen. Over the next two decades, he worked in a wide range of Hindi and regional films, including Punjabi, Telugu, Tamil, Kannada, Bengali, and Malayalam cinema.

He was last seen in the Hindi film Anth The End. His nuanced performances across genres left a lasting impression on both audiences and colleagues. Fans across the country took to social media to share memories of his iconic roles and extend condolences to his family.
